Leo Chan, as the C.E.O. and Co-Founder of TofuKungFu (TKF), brings a unique blend of biotechnology expertise and cultural passion to the fashion industry. With over 15 years of experience in biotechnology, Leo has honed his skills in imaging cytometry, cell-based assay development, and microfluidic devices, leading teams of scientists to innovate and deliver cutting-edge products. This scientific acumen informs his approach to TKF, where he applies principles of precision and creativity to the design and production of apparel that celebrates Chinese culture.
At TofuKungFu, Leo and his partner Bryan Cheng have embarked on a mission to bridge cultural gaps through fashion, focusing primarily on t-shirts that tell stories and promote the rich heritage of their American-Chinese upbringing. Under Leo's leadership, TKF has launched several key projects that not only highlight traditional Chinese motifs but also incorporate modern design elements, making them appealing to a diverse audience. His background in sales management and operations has been instrumental in establishing strategic partnerships and expanding the brand's reach within the competitive fashion landscape.
Leo's commitment to cultural education through fashion is evident in TKF's initiatives, which include collaborations with artists and cultural ambassadors to create limited-edition collections that resonate with both the Chinese community and broader audiences. By leveraging his biotechnology background, Leo approaches product development with a meticulous eye for detail, ensuring that every piece not only looks good but also embodies the values of innovation and respect for tradition. As TofuKungFu continues to grow, Leo Chan remains dedicated to fostering a deeper understanding of Chinese culture while making a lasting impact in the fashion industry.
